Road cycling routes around Bresegard bei Eldena are characterized by the tranquil River Elde and the expansive Sternberger Seenland Nature Park. The region, located in Mecklenburg-Vorpommern, Germany, features generally flat or gently rolling terrain, making it suitable for various fitness levels. Cyclists can explore routes along the Elde cycle path and the Müritz-Elde Waterway, offering scenic views through natural landscapes. The area provides a network of mostly paved surfaces, ideal for road bikes.

There are over 35 road cycling routes around Bresegard bei Eldena, offering a variety of options for different preferences and fitness levels. You'll find a good mix of easy and moderate trails to explore.
The region around Bresegard bei Eldena is characterized by generally flat or gently rolling terrain, especially along the River Elde and the Müritz-Elde Waterway. This makes it well-suited for road cycling, providing an enjoyable experience without overly strenuous climbs.
Yes, approximately 14 of the road cycling routes in the area are classified as easy. These routes are perfect for beginners or those looking for a relaxed ride, often featuring mostly paved surfaces and gentle gradients.
Road cycling routes in this region offer picturesque views of the tranquil River Elde and the expansive Sternberger Seenland Nature Park. You can expect serene natural landscapes, often following waterways and passing through charming countryside.
Absolutely. Many routes pass by significant historical and cultural sites. A notable highlight is the magnificent Ludwigslust Palace, a baroque masterpiece with an expansive park. You might also encounter the historic St. Helena and St. Andreas Church within the palace park.
Yes, the region boasts unique natural features. For instance, the 24 water jumps, a natural monument powered by hydropower, offers a tranquil and interesting spot to visit during your ride.
Many of the road cycling routes around Bresegard bei Eldena are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end your journey in the same location. An example is the Ludwigslust Palace – Ludwigslust Palace and Park loop from Glaisin, which is an easy 48.1 km ride.
